Print, lithograph, The Rival Quixotes, A Parody on Parody, by John Doyle (H.B.) (Dublin 1797 – London 1868). Part collection (49) of HB Sketches. Published by T. McLean, 26 Haymarket. No.574 12th Feb 1839. Featuring: John George Lambton, 1st Earl of Durham, GCB, MP (1792-1840) and Henry Brougham, Baron Brougham and Vaux (1778-1868). Lord Brougham (right) unseated Lord Durham from his Government of Canada
